Tim Tams
- Preparation time
- 45 min
- Servings
- serves 4
Ingredients
serves 4
- Butter — to buy125 g
- Sugar — to buy100 g
- Vanilla pod — to buy1 tsp
- Flour — to buy200 g
- Cornstarch — to buy30 g
- Chocolate — to buy250 g
Preparation
Preheat the oven to 180°C and line a tray with parchment paper.
Beat the softened butter with the sugar until creamy, then add the vanilla extract.
Fold in the sifted flour and cornstarch to form a soft dough.
Roll the dough out thinly between two sheets of parchment and cut into 3 x 6 cm rectangles.
Place them on the tray and bake for 10 to 12 minutes until golden at the edges, then let cool.
Melt the chocolate in a double boiler and spread melted chocolate over half of the biscuits.
Sandwich with a second biscuit, then coat the whole outside with melted chocolate using a fork.
Place on a rack and let the chocolate set in the fridge before eating.
